Ratnagiri Temple

Rathnagiri is a temple devoted to Lord Balamurugan located at Rathnagiri, Walaja Taluk about 10 km from Vellore. Balamurugan adimaigal was the one responsible for developing this hilltop temple from the year 1968. Under his guidance a well equipped hospital and a very good school was founded. All the people belong to Kilminal also responsible for the development of this temple complex. Under the auspicious of the Balamuruganadimai an emergency medical service unit is available near to the Ratnagiri hospital on the Madras Bangalore highway. The temple is very well maintained and known for its popularity among CMC visitors and the general public of Tamil Nadu. A 4 hair-pin bend road leads to the temple. A small entry fees for vehicles is charged as the ghat road was recently laid. Another option would be to take nearly 150 odd steps to reach the temple.
